在当今数据驱动的时代,评分数据已成为评估个人和团队绩效的关键工具。无论是企业绩效管理、教育评估,还是项目管理,评分数据都能提供客观的反馈,帮助识别优势、改进不足。本文将详细指导您如何高效获取评分数据,并利用这些数据提升个人或团队绩效。文章将涵盖评分数据的定义、获取方法、分析技巧以及实际应用案例,确保内容详实、逻辑清晰,并提供可操作的步骤。
1. 理解评分数据及其重要性
评分数据是指通过量化指标对个人或团队表现进行评估的结果。这些数据通常以分数、百分比或等级形式呈现,例如员工绩效评分、项目完成度评分或客户满意度评分。评分数据的重要性在于它提供了客观的基准,帮助管理者或个人做出数据驱动的决策。
1.1 评分数据的类型
- 个人评分数据:如员工绩效评估、技能测试分数或360度反馈评分。
- 团队评分数据:如项目完成率、团队协作评分或客户反馈评分。
- 综合评分数据:结合多个维度的评分,例如平衡计分卡(BSC)或关键绩效指标(KPI)评分。
1.2 评分数据的价值
- 识别改进领域:通过低分项发现弱点,制定针对性培训计划。
- 激励与奖励:高分数据可用于奖励优秀个人或团队,提升士气。
- 战略决策支持:长期评分数据趋势可指导资源分配和战略调整。
示例:一家科技公司使用季度绩效评分数据,发现团队在“创新”维度得分较低,从而引入了创新工作坊,最终提升了整体绩效。
2. 高效获取评分数据的方法
获取评分数据需要系统化的方法,确保数据来源可靠、收集过程高效。以下是几种常见且高效的获取途径。
2.1 利用现有系统和工具
许多组织已部署绩效管理系统(如Workday、SAP SuccessFactors)或项目管理工具(如Jira、Asana),这些工具通常内置评分功能。您可以直接导出数据进行分析。
步骤:
- 登录绩效管理系统,进入报告模块。
- 选择时间范围(如上一季度)和评估对象(个人或团队)。
- 导出数据为CSV或Excel格式,便于后续处理。
代码示例(Python):如果您从系统导出CSV文件,可以使用Pandas库快速读取和分析数据。
import pandas as pd
# 读取评分数据CSV文件
data = pd.read_csv('performance_scores.csv')
# 查看数据摘要
print(data.head())
print(data.describe())
# 示例输出:
# Employee_ID Innovation_Score Collaboration_Score Overall_Score
# 0 101 7.5 8.2 7.8
# 1 102 6.0 9.0 7.5
2.2 设计和实施自定义评估
如果现有系统不满足需求,可以设计自定义评估表。使用在线工具如Google Forms、SurveyMonkey或Typeform创建评分问卷,收集反馈。
步骤:
- 确定评估维度(如技能、态度、成果)。
- 设计问题,使用李克特量表(1-5分)或百分比评分。
- 分发给相关评估者(如同事、上级、客户)。
- 收集并汇总数据。
示例:团队领导设计了一个“项目协作评分表”,包含5个维度,每个维度1-10分。通过Google Forms收集后,自动汇总到Google Sheets,再导出为Excel。
2.3 第三方数据源
对于外部评分数据,如客户满意度评分(CSAT)或行业基准数据,可以利用第三方平台。例如,使用NPS(净推荐值)工具或行业报告。
步骤:
- 注册第三方平台(如SurveyMonkey、Qualtrics)。
- 配置数据收集模板。
- 定期导出数据报告。
注意事项:确保数据隐私合规(如GDPR),并获取必要的同意。
2.4 自动化数据收集
对于高频数据(如每日任务评分),可以使用API或自动化脚本。例如,通过Slack或Microsoft Teams的集成工具自动收集反馈。
代码示例(Python):使用Slack API自动收集每日评分。
import requests
import json
# Slack API配置
slack_token = 'your_slack_token'
channel_id = 'C123456'
# 发送评分请求
def send_rating_request():
message = {
"channel": channel_id,
"text": "请对今日工作完成度评分(1-10分):"
}
response = requests.post('https://slack.com/api/chat.postMessage',
headers={'Authorization': f'Bearer {slack_token}'},
data=json.dumps(message))
return response.json()
# 收集回复(简化版,实际需处理事件订阅)
# 此处省略复杂事件处理逻辑
3. 分析评分数据:从原始数据到洞察
获取数据后,需要分析以提取有价值的信息。分析过程包括数据清洗、可视化、统计分析和趋势识别。
3.1 数据清洗与预处理
原始数据可能包含缺失值、异常值或格式错误。使用工具如Excel或Python进行清洗。
步骤:
- 检查缺失值:用平均值或中位数填充,或删除无效记录。
- 处理异常值:例如,评分超过10分视为错误,需修正。
- 标准化数据:将不同维度的评分统一到相同尺度。
代码示例(Python):使用Pandas清洗数据。
import pandas as pd
import numpy as np
# 模拟数据
data = pd.DataFrame({
'Employee_ID': [101, 102, 103, 104],
'Innovation_Score': [7.5, 6.0, np.nan, 12.0], # 包含缺失值和异常值
'Collaboration_Score': [8.2, 9.0, 7.5, 8.0]
})
# 填充缺失值
data['Innovation_Score'].fillna(data['Innovation_Score'].mean(), inplace=True)
# 修正异常值(假设评分上限为10)
data['Innovation_Score'] = data['Innovation_Score'].clip(0, 10)
print(data)
3.2 数据可视化
可视化帮助直观理解数据分布和趋势。常用工具包括Excel图表、Tableau或Python的Matplotlib/Seaborn。
示例:使用Python绘制团队评分柱状图。
import matplotlib.pyplot as plt
import seaborn as sns
# 假设清洗后的数据
team_scores = pd.DataFrame({
'维度': ['创新', '协作', '效率', '质量'],
'平均分': [7.8, 8.5, 8.0, 9.2]
})
# 绘制柱状图
plt.figure(figsize=(8, 5))
sns.barplot(x='维度', y='平均分', data=team_scores, palette='viridis')
plt.title('团队各维度评分')
plt.ylabel('平均分')
plt.show()
3.3 统计分析
使用描述性统计(均值、标准差)和推断性统计(相关性分析、回归分析)深入挖掘数据。
示例:计算个人评分与团队评分的相关性。
# 假设个人评分数据
personal_scores = pd.DataFrame({
'Employee_ID': [101, 102, 103, 104],
'Personal_Score': [7.8, 7.5, 8.2, 8.0]
})
# 合并数据
merged_data = pd.merge(data, personal_scores, on='Employee_ID')
# 计算相关性
correlation = merged_data[['Innovation_Score', 'Personal_Score']].corr()
print(correlation)
3.4 趋势识别
分析时间序列数据,识别改进或退步趋势。例如,使用移动平均线平滑数据。
示例:分析季度评分趋势。
# 模拟季度数据
quarterly_data = pd.DataFrame({
'Quarter': ['Q1', 'Q2', 'Q3', 'Q4'],
'Team_Score': [7.5, 8.0, 8.2, 8.5]
})
# 计算移动平均
quarterly_data['Moving_Avg'] = quarterly_data['Team_Score'].rolling(window=2).mean()
print(quarterly_data)
4. 利用评分数据提升绩效
分析后,关键在于将洞察转化为行动。以下是针对个人和团队的具体策略。
4.1 提升个人绩效
- 个性化发展计划:基于低分项制定学习目标。例如,如果“技术技能”评分低,安排在线课程或导师指导。
- 定期反馈循环:每月回顾评分,调整行为。使用SMART目标(具体、可衡量、可实现、相关、有时限)。
- 激励机制:将高分与奖励挂钩,如奖金或晋升机会。
案例:一位销售员工在“客户关系”评分中得6分(满分10分)。通过分析,发现是跟进不及时。他设置了每日提醒系统,三个月后评分提升至8.5分。
4.2 提升团队绩效
- 团队培训与协作:针对低分维度组织工作坊。例如,如果“协作”评分低,开展团队建设活动。
- 资源优化:根据评分分配资源。高绩效团队获得更多预算,低绩效团队获得更多支持。
- 文化塑造:公开表彰高分团队,营造积极氛围。
案例:一个软件开发团队在“代码质量”评分中持续偏低。团队引入了代码审查工具(如SonarQube),并定期进行代码评审会议。六个月后,评分从6.8提升至8.9。
4.3 持续改进循环
建立PDCA(计划-执行-检查-行动)循环:
- 计划:基于评分设定目标。
- 执行:实施改进措施。
- 检查:定期收集新评分数据。
- 行动:根据结果调整策略。
代码示例(Python):模拟一个简单的改进循环跟踪。
# 假设初始评分和目标
initial_score = 7.0
target_score = 8.5
improvement_actions = ['培训', '工具引入', '流程优化']
# 模拟每月评分变化
monthly_scores = [7.0, 7.5, 8.0, 8.2, 8.5]
# 检查是否达到目标
if monthly_scores[-1] >= target_score:
print("目标达成!")
else:
print("继续改进。")
# 输出趋势
for i, score in enumerate(monthly_scores):
print(f"第{i+1}个月评分: {score}")
5. 注意事项与最佳实践
- 数据隐私:确保评分数据匿名化处理,遵守相关法律法规。
- 公平性:避免偏见,使用多评估者减少主观性。
- 工具选择:根据组织规模选择工具,小型团队可用Excel,大型企业用专业系统。
- 持续学习:关注最新绩效管理趋势,如AI驱动的评分分析。
6. 结论
高效获取和利用评分数据是提升个人和团队绩效的核心。通过系统化收集、深入分析和行动导向的策略,您可以将数据转化为实际改进。记住,评分数据不是终点,而是持续优化的起点。开始行动吧,从今天的数据收集开始,逐步构建您的绩效提升体系。
通过本文的指南,您应该能够自信地处理评分数据,并在实际场景中应用。如果您有特定场景或工具需求,可以进一步定制方法。
